Afraid
Tim Taylor 1961 (North Carolina)
Summertime came and so quickly now gone.
This makes three now, since I’ve been alone.
I thought before summer’s end, I’d surely return.
To a place I so foolishly thought I belonged.
Now I know.
I will never go home.
A tab has been kept.
The toll must be paid.
For the years of darkness, I made.
For the way I behaved.
I closed my eyes and for a moment I prayed
God, please help me be not so afraid.
Now my thoughts are racing so fast.
The sounds they make are the ghosts from my past.
With each passing sunset getting harder than last.
My fear is, that my fate has been cast!
Just in that moment my phone began ringing.
My son just wanted to know, what I’ve been thinking.
I did not speak of the dark places I’ve gone.
Then he told me that he felt alone.
And with hearing my voice he was closer to home.
He said that he loved me then hung up the phone.
Feeling much better, hearing from someone who cares.
The words I just heard!
An answer to the prayer!
I no longer was scared.
God just let me know, he will always be there.
